A washhouse with a gable roof, a small window and three doors, with a commemorative plaque, located in Liverdun
At the top of the village is this washing machine that has existed since 1901. Consisting of a two-sided roof, a small window and three doors, it was intended, at the time of Mayor Nicolas Noël, to relieve the lavandières in their work by providing them with access to the banks of the Moselle. Its large basin is divided into two unequal parts and the walls are longés by a bench. This washing machine was used until recently. You are invited to read the commemorative plaque installed on the top of the washer and to contemplate the bricks made of bricks in this "closed" building.
